Changing Epidemiological Patterns and the Viral Catalyst

Historically, head and neck malignancies were overwhelmingly associated with long-term tobacco use and heavy alcohol consumption. While these traditional risk factors remain substantial contributors, particularly across developing economies, a dramatic epidemiological shift is underway. The surging incidence of Human Papillomavirus (HPV)-associated head and neck cancers, particularly oropharyngeal squamous cell carcinomas, has fundamentally transformed patient demographics.

HPV-positive tumors behave differently than traditional tobacco-induced malignancies; they typically manifest in younger, otherwise healthy demographics and exhibit distinct biological behaviors. This structural shift in the patient universe creates an urgent demand for novel therapeutic protocols tailored to prolonged survival and long-term toxicity management, expanding the commercial addressable market for advanced therapeutics.

The Rise of Non-Invasive, High-Precision Diagnostics

Early intervention remains the single most critical determinant of long-term survival in head and neck oncology. The widespread commercialization of advanced imaging technologies, combined with the emergence of non-invasive screening modalities, is driving early detection rates globally.

Liquid biopsies, which detect circulating tumor DNA (ctDNA) and exosomes from simple blood or saliva samples, are moving from experimental trials into routine clinical practice. These diagnostic innovations allow clinicians to identify malignancies at asymptomatic stages, monitor real-time therapeutic responses, and detect minimal residual disease long before physical recurrence manifests. For market participants, the growth of the diagnostic ecosystem acts as a direct multiplier for drug demand, ensuring that patients enter the therapeutic funnel much earlier in their disease progression.

Drug Class Dynamics: The Dominance of EGFR Inhibitors

In 2024, Epidermal Growth Factor Receptor (EGFR) inhibitors firmly anchored the global market. The biological rationale for this dominance is clear: EGFR is overexpressed in the vast majority of head and neck squamous cell carcinomas (HNSCC), serving as a primary driver of tumor cell proliferation, angiogenesis, and cell survival.

Monoclonal antibodies designed to target this pathway, notably cetuximab (Erbitux), have long established themselves as standard components of care. When combined with radiation therapy or traditional chemotherapy regimens, these agents have demonstrated clear improvements in overall survival and progression-free survival. The segment’s leading position is sustained by extensive clinical validation, broad regulatory approvals across all major global geographies, and established physician familiarity. Moving forward, the EGFR segment is evolving through clinical trials evaluating next-generation small-molecule inhibitors and novel combination therapies designed to bypass acquired resistance mechanisms.

Therapy Types: The Rapid Ascent of Immunotherapy

While EGFR inhibitors hold substantial market share, the immunotherapy segment is projected to grow at the fastest rate over the forecast period, positioned to redefine the global standard of care. The therapeutic philosophy of immunotherapy revolves around unleashing the patient's own immune system to recognize and eliminate malignant cells.

Immune checkpoint inhibitors, specifically those targeting the Programmed Death-1 (PD-1) and Programmed Death Ligand-1 (PD-L1) pathways, have delivered remarkable outcomes in recurrent or metastatic settings. Blockbuster agents such as pembrolizumab (Keytruda) and nivolumab (Opdivo) provide durable clinical responses and long-term survival benefits that conventional chemotherapeutic agents rarely achieve. Backed by strong recommendations from leading global oncology bodies, including the National Comprehensive Cancer Network (NCCN) and the American Society of Clinical Oncology (ASCO), immunotherapies are rapidly moving into first-line treatment settings. Furthermore, their lower systemic toxicity profiles compared to conventional cell-killing chemotherapies significantly improve patient compliance and quality of life, cementing their commercial and clinical dominance.

Asia-Pacific: The High-Volume Growth Engine

The Asia-Pacific region is poised to log the fastest growth rate over the upcoming decade. Geographically, certain sub-regions within Asia-Pacific exhibit some of the highest incidence rates of head and neck cancer globally, frequently driven by deeply ingrained cultural habits such as betel nut chewing, tobacco smoking, and smokeless tobacco use.

As disposable incomes rise and governments across nations like China, India, Japan, and South Korea expand public health insurance coverage, the demand for advanced Western oncology drugs is surging. Local manufacturers are concurrently entering partnerships with multinational corporations to run regional clinical trials and build local manufacturing facilities, aiming to lower production costs and make advanced targeted therapies accessible to broader patient populations.

Bridging the Accessibility and Expertise Gap

Administering sophisticated immunotherapies and managing their unique immune-related side effects requires highly specialized medical expertise and advanced clinical infrastructure. Outside of major metropolitan medical centers and elite academic research institutions, there is a distinct shortage of trained oncologists, oncology nurses, and advanced diagnostic facilities.

In rural and underserved regions, delayed diagnoses and fragmented care pathways often lead to poor patient outcomes and underutilization of advanced therapeutics. Corporate leaders can address this infrastructure bottleneck by investing in comprehensive medical education initiatives, supporting the deployment of AI-driven remote diagnostic tools, and partnering with local healthcare systems to standardize advanced oncology care protocols across regional networks.

The Competitive Landscape: M&A Activity, Strategic Alliances, and Clinical Portfolios

The competitive landscape of the Head and Neck Cancer Market is dynamic and intensely contested, characterized by continuous research and development races, high-stakes mergers and acquisitions, and multi-institutional research alliances. Global pharmaceutical conglomerates are focused on defending their market share while expanding their therapeutic pipelines into next-generation modalities.

Key industry leaders—including Merck & Co., Bristol-Myers Squibb, Eli Lilly, AstraZeneca, F. Hoffmann-La Roche, Sanofi, and Takeda—regularly adjust their corporate strategies to secure a competitive edge. Company portfolios are increasingly built around combination therapies. Recognizing that tumors frequently employ multiple redundant pathways to evade the immune system, developers are actively testing treatments that combine established anti-PD-1 checkpoint blockers with novel agents, such as anti-LAG-3, anti-TIGIT, or cancer vaccines.

Strategic corporate collaborations are playing a vital role in accelerating early-stage drug development. For instance, partnerships between focused biotechnology innovators and major cancer research centers, such as Aprea Therapeutics' clinical collaborations with the MD Anderson Cancer Center, are critical for moving novel small molecules through early phase testing.

Simultaneously, targeted corporate acquisitions allow industry leaders to rapidly absorb cutting-edge technologies. A prominent example includes Eli Lilly’s acquisition of specialized targeted programs to reinforce its precision oncology portfolio against various solid tumors, including head and neck malignancies. As clinical pipelines mature, the firms that successfully match specific biomarkers to targeted therapies will be best positioned to capture long-term market share.
